A lovely half-day walk around Pitlochry, visiting a spectacular waterfall, a ruined castle, an old coaching inn and brewery, Pitlochry dam and fish ladder and a bouncy bridge! This walk offers super views of Pitlochry.
Starting at the Pitlochry information centre, we walk up through the woods below the Atholl Palace Hotel to the spectacular Black Spout, a 60m waterfall. After following paths through woods and fields, we come to the ruined Caisteal Dubh (the “Black Castle”) which has an interesting story to tell. After visiting Moulin, with its old coaching inn and brewery, we walk past the Dane's Stone and then down to The Cuilc. We then walk down to the banks of Loch Faskally. After crossing the dam we walk down beside the famous fish ladder and across a bouncy bridge! The path soon brings us back into the centre of Pitlochry. The walk offers super views of Pitlochry and Ben Vrackie, and it follows mainly good paths and tracks, but with a field to cross to reach the Caisteal Dubh.
The walk starts and finishes at the Pitlochry iCentre (the tourist information centre) on Atholl Road in the centre of Pitlochry. The walk is 8.5km with a total ascent of 210m and will take approx 4 hours. We can run the walk in the morning (starting at 930am) or the afternoon (starting at 1pm).
